Toilet installation services we provide
New fittings, connected properly and tested before we leave:
Like-for-like replacement
Swapping an old toilet for a new one on the existing waste and supply points, matched to the room's layout so the new unit sits exactly where the old one did, finished and sealed in one visit.
Dual-flush and water-efficient units
Fitting a modern dual-flush toilet where a heavier original cistern currently sits, giving the household an immediate, measurable drop in water use without changing anything else about the bathroom.
Wall-faced and concealed cistern units
Installing a wall-faced toilet with a concealed cistern where the wall cavity genuinely supports it, giving a cleaner finish for a renovation without compromising access for future servicing.
Repositioned or relocated toilets
Moving a toilet to a new position within a renovated bathroom, running new waste and supply lines to the fresh location and confirming the fall on the new run before anything's tiled over.

Two decisions worth getting right before booking
Comfort height versus standard height
A comfort-height toilet sits noticeably taller than a standard unit, which suits some households and feels wrong to others, so it's worth deciding before the plumber arrives rather than mid-installation.
Matching the existing rough-in
The distance from the wall to the waste outlet, known as the rough-in, varies between older and newer fittings, and getting this measurement right before ordering avoids a returned toilet and a wasted trip.

What a rushed or amateur installation costs later
A toilet that isn't sealed and levelled properly rarely stays trouble-free:
- A poor seal shows up as a leak eventually. Water tracking out from an improperly fitted base can sit under the flooring for months before the real source is ever traced.
- An unlevel toilet stresses its own connections. A unit that rocks even slightly puts ongoing strain on the wax or rubber seal underneath, shortening its working life considerably.
- Getting it wrong twice costs more than getting it right once. A DIY install that needs professional correction later almost always costs more overall than booking a licensed plumber from the start.

Can a new toilet be fitted in place of a much older model?
Yes, most modern toilets connect to the same waste and supply points an older one used, and any small adjustment needed for a different outlet position gets sorted during the same visit.
How long does installing a new toilet actually take?
A straightforward swap onto existing plumbing is usually done in one visit, while a repositioned toilet or a full bathroom layout change naturally takes longer to plan and fit properly.
Do dual-flush toilets genuinely save much water over an older single-flush model?
Meaningfully, yes, an original 1950s single-flush cistern uses far more water per flush than a modern dual-flush unit, so the saving becomes obvious the very first quarter after installing one.
Is a wall-faced toilet an option in an older bathroom?
Sometimes, though it depends on what's already inside the wall cavity, and we'll assess that honestly before quoting rather than promising a look that the existing plumbing can't actually support.
